Funeral Announcement for Kevin Cleary
•
With great sadness we announce that Kevin Cleary passed away peacefully in the early morning on January 16, 2014 in Kyoto in the presence of family. Kevin was an exemplary teacher, author, leader, and most of all, friend.
Naoko Fujiwara 藤原 直子様(奥様)(Kevin’s wife) would like to invite all of Kevin’s friends and colleagues to the wake and funeral. Services will be held in Tokyo at St. Ignatius (Kojimachi Catholic Church) at Sophia University in Yotsuya. The wake will be held at 19:30 pm on Tuesday, 21 January 2014, in the Main Chapel. A funeral mass will be said in Kevin’s memory at 13:30 pm on Wednesday, 22 January 2014, also in the Main Chapel. If you would like to send flowers, please contact 栄光式典社 (03-3370-4902). To send a condolence card, please mail it to JALT Central Office. We will collect all of the cards and take them to the family. It is customary to give money as a condolence gift at funerals in Japan. At Buddhist funerals, this is called 香典 (Kouden). However, these are Catholic services, so it is called お花料 (Ohanaryo). If you cannot find a special Ohanaryo envelope, please use a 御霊前 (Goreizen) which you can find at many stationery shops, or even convenience stores. A plain white envelope is also acceptable. St. Ignatius Church (Kojimachi Catholic Church) is 1 minute from Yotsuya Station on the JR Chuo Line and the Marunouchi and Namboku Subway Lines. The Main Chapel seats 800 and there is a barrier-free entrance. More information can be found at http://www.ignatius.gr.jp/ in English and Japanese. The church does not respond to inquiries by email, but you may contact them directly by phone (03-3263-4584) or FAX (03-3263-4585).
Kevin was important to so many of us. If you are able to, please come to Tokyo to gather in remembrance of his life and friendship.
